Spectrophotometric determination of Risperidone in pharmaceutical preparations by Charge-Transfer Reactions

A simple, rapid and sensitive method for the spectrophotometric determination of risperidone (RIS) has been developed. The proposed method is based on the charge–transfer reactions of risperidone as electron donor, with 7,7,8,8,-tetra-cyanoquinodimethane (TCNQ) , 2,3-dichloro-5,6-dicyano-1,4-benzoquinone (DDQ) , tetracyanoethylene (TCNE) and chloranilic acid(CA) as ?-acceptors to give colored complexes. The experimental conditions such as reagent concentration, reaction solvent, temperature and time have been optimized to achieve the highest sensitivity. Beer's law is obeyed over the concentration ranges of 8 – 150, 25 – 250, 5 – 70 and 10 – 110 µgml-1 risperidone using DDQ, CA, TCNE and TCNQ respectively, with corresponding correlation coefficients of 0.9995, 0.9993, 0.9990 & 0.9997 and detection limits of 3.62, 8.66, 1.93 and 2 .85 µgml-1 for the reagents in the same order.
